Michele Clucas - Blue Sea

Each breath, marking time’s passage –
Eternity in the clear blue sea!
I slowly drift, deeper into this world
Flashes of colour, the underwater carnival -
Join in never ending indigo
The sharp, crackling sound of living reef
Punctuates the slow in and out of each breath
As I slow, fields of coral enter my world
Waving feathery and soft; standing smooth and hard
Colours from dawn’s red to midnight’s blue
The green of natures coat to mother earth’s rich hue
Soft white sand drifts –
The push and pull of the current guarding its rest
Bright colours of movement in the darkness of a coral crevice;
Life winking at me as it plays in this coral keep.
Michele Clucas
